The job market in Patrick, VA County is looking bright. The future job growth in the county is expected to be 25.92%, which is slightly lower than the national average of 30.54%. Additionally, the unemployment rate of 3.9% in Patrick, VA County is lower than the national average of 4.1%, indicating a strong and robust job market for those looking for employment opportunities. This bodes well for workers in the area who are seeking stable employment and suggests a positive outlook for the future job growth in the county.

  Average Salary by OccupationPatrick, VirginiaUnited States
  Management$66,496$77,236
  Business, Financial$51,813$68,299
  Computer, Math$114,667$87,306
  Architecture, Engineering $86,023
  Sciences $66,034
  Social Service$34,167$44,925
  Legal $88,013
  Education$41,917$44,678
  Arts, Entertainment$25,703$43,591
  Health Practitioners$62,768$75,327
  Health Technicians$36,791$41,524
  Healthcare Support$21,793$25,441
  Fire Fighters$46,635$35,516
  Law Enforcement$50,967$64,941
  Food Prep, Serving$12,462$16,379
  Cleaning, Maintenance$22,143$23,378
  Personal Care$28,718$15,351
  Sales, Related$27,500$33,178
  Office Admin, Support$31,584$35,058
  Farming, Fishing, Forestry$26,576$25,716
  Construction, Extraction$26,122$41,315
  Maintence, Repair$42,630$48,436
  Production$29,662$38,103
  Transportation$23,250$39,572
  Material Moving$30,250$25,906
  Average Salary by IndustryPatrick, VirginiaUnited States
  Agriculture, Forestry, Fishing and Hunting$26,957$31,273
  Mining, Quarrying, and Oil and Gas Extraction $74,432
  Construction$27,051$44,287
  Manufacturing$38,767$51,585
  Wholesale Trade$36,362$51,301
  Retail Trade$25,451$26,757
  Transportation and Warehousing$31,250$43,256
  Utilities$79,189$77,546
  Information$24,952$61,268
  Finance and Insurance$94,494$65,016
  Real Estate and Rental and Leasing$42,375$46,406
  Professional, Scientific, and Technical Services$76,103$73,907
  Management of Companies and Enterprises $75,118
  Administrative and Support and Waste Services$19,737$30,687
  Educational Services$42,217$44,708
  Health Care and Social Assistance$31,437$40,852
  Arts, Entertainment, and Recreation$37,824$25,861
  Accommodation and Food Services$22,083$18,154
  Other Services$28,807$29,481
  Public Administration$47,115$61,644
